Root partitions panic with a trace similar to: [ 81.306348] reboot: Power down [ 81.314709] mce: [Hardware Error]: CPU 0: Machine Check Exception: 4 B= ank 0: b2000000c0060001 [ 81.314711] mce: [Hardware Error]: TSC 3b8cb60a66 PPIN 11d98332458e4ea9 [ 81.314713] mce: [Hardware Error]: PROCESSOR 0:606a6 TIME 1759339405 S= OCKET 0 APIC 0 microcode ffffffff [ 81.314715] mce: [Hardware Error]: Run the above through 'mcelog --asc= ii' [ 81.314716] mce: [Hardware Error]: Machine check: Processor context co= rrupt [ 81.314717] Kernel panic - not syncing: Fatal machine check To avoid this, configure the sleep state in the hypervisor and invoke the HVCALL_ENTER_SLEEP_STATE hypercall as the final step in the shutdown sequence. This ensures a clean and safe shutdown of the root partition.
